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Picasso Museum (Musée Picasso) in Antibes, which houses a collection of artworks by Pablo Picasso. Explore the museum and admire the artist's masterpieces.
Afternoon
Head to the old town of Nice and wander through the narrow streets filled with colorful buildings and charming shops. Visit the Cours Saleya Market, where you can find fresh produce, flowers, and local specialties. Enjoy a delicious lunch at a nearby restaurant, such as La Cambuse Du Saunier, known for its seafood dishes.

Morning
Explore the beautiful city of Nice further by visiting the stunning Castle Hill (Colline du Château), which offers panoramic views of the city and the sea. Take a leisurely walk through the park and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.
Afternoon
Visit the Marc Chagall National Museum, which houses a collection of artworks by the famous Russian-French artist. Admire Chagall's colorful and dreamlike paintings.
Evening
Enjoy a relaxing evening by taking a stroll along the Promenade du Paillon, a lovely park in Nice. Take a seat on one of the benches and enjoy the beautiful surroundings. For dinner, try La Zucca Magica, a vegetarian restaurant known for its creative and flavorful dishes.
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Old Town of Antibes. Explore the narrow streets and discover the charming shops and cafes. Visit the Antibes Cathedral (Cathédrale Notre-Dame-de-la-Platea d'Antibes) and admire its beautiful architecture.
Afternoon
Head to Port Vauban , one of the largest marinas in Europe. Take a stroll along the harbor and admire the luxurious yachts. Visit the Fort Carré, a historic fortress that offers stunning views of the Mediterranean Sea.
Morning
Visit the Musée Matisse, which houses a collection of artworks by the famous French artist Henri Matisse. Admire his colorful and innovative paintings.
Afternoon
Take a trip to the charming village of Saint-Paul-de-Vence, located just a short drive from Nice. Explore the narrow streets and visit the Fondation Maeght, a modern art museum that showcases works by artists such as Joan Miró and Marc Chagall.
Morning
Take a day trip to the picturesque village of Eze, located between Nice and Monaco. Explore the medieval streets and visit the Jardin Exotique d'Eze, a stunning garden with panoramic views of the French Riviera.
Afternoon
Head to the city of Antibes and visit the Musée Picasso once again to further explore the artist's works. Afterward, take a walk along the Antibes Ramparts, which offer beautiful views of the Mediterranean Sea.
